Arsenal's Gabriel Martinelli Earns High Acclaim from Declan Rice After Crucial Role in 4-3 Triumph Against Luton Town
In a night of extraordinary highs and lows, Arsenal clinched a dramatic 4-3 victory over Luton Town, with standout performances from Gabriel Martinelli and Declan Rice. Martinelli, who opened the scoring in the 20th minute, and Rice, who secured the winner in the 97th minute, showcased their prowess in a match filled with twists.
The Gunners initially allowed Luton Town to stage a comeback after some subpar defending from a corner, momentarily losing their lead.
Despite Gabriel Jesus restoring Arsenal's lead before halftime, Luton Town managed to level the score once again from another corner, capitalizing on a mistake from goalkeeper David Raya.
Raya's subsequent error allowed Ross Barkley to score, creating an air of uncertainty for Arsenal fans.
However, Kai Havertz swiftly equalized, setting the stage for Declan Rice's dramatic winning goal. This victory propelled the Gunners five points clear at the top of the Premier League table.
